- The distance between Norwalk, Oh, Usa and Palmerston N (aero), New Zealand is approximately 13,668 km or 8,494 mi.
- To reach Norwalk, Oh in this distance one would set out from Palmerston N (aero) bearing 61.3°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Norwalk, Oh bearing 62.8° or ENE .
- Norwalk, Oh has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Palmerston N (aero) has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Norwalk, Oh is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Palmerston N (aero) is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 3.5 °C (6.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.1 °C (30.8°F) more in Norwalk, Oh.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 9.3 mm (0.4 in) more which is equivalent to 9.3 l/m² (0.23 US gal/ft²) or 93,000 l/ha (9,942 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.2° lower in Norwalk, Oh than in Palmerston N (aero).
